
OATH by CREDITOR Form


What is the Oath by Creditor?
The Oath by Creditor is a legal document that allows a creditor to affirm under oath the validity of their claim against a debtor. This form is often used in bankruptcy proceedings or civil court cases to establish the legitimacy of the creditor's debt. The oath serves as a sworn statement, providing a formal declaration that the creditor has a right to collect the owed amount based on the terms of the original agreement or contract.
How to Use the Oath by Creditor
To effectively use the Oath by Creditor, the creditor must complete the form accurately, ensuring all necessary information is included. This includes details about the debtor, the amount owed, and any relevant agreements that support the claim. Once completed, the form must be signed in the presence of a notary public to verify the authenticity of the signature and the oath. This notarization adds a layer of credibility to the document, making it more likely to be accepted in legal proceedings.
Steps to Complete the Oath by Creditor
Completing the Oath by Creditor involves several key steps:
- Gather all relevant documentation, including contracts, invoices, and any correspondence related to the debt.
- Fill out the form with accurate information about the debtor and the debt amount.
- Review the completed form for any errors or omissions.
- Sign the form in front of a notary public to ensure it is legally binding.
- Submit the notarized form to the appropriate court or agency as required.
Legal Use of the Oath by Creditor
The Oath by Creditor is legally recognized in various jurisdictions within the United States. It is primarily used in situations where a creditor needs to prove the validity of their claim in court. By submitting this sworn statement, creditors can strengthen their position in legal disputes and may facilitate the collection of debts. It is essential for creditors to understand the specific legal requirements in their state, as these can vary significantly.
Key Elements of the Oath by Creditor
Key elements of the Oath by Creditor include:
- Creditor Information: Full name and contact details of the creditor.
- Debtor Information: Full name and contact details of the debtor.
- Debt Details: The total amount owed and the basis for the claim.
- Signature: The creditor's signature, which must be notarized.
- Affirmation: A statement affirming the truthfulness of the claim under penalty of perjury.
Examples of Using the Oath by Creditor
Examples of situations where the Oath by Creditor may be utilized include:
- A creditor seeking to collect a past-due credit card balance.
- A business attempting to recover unpaid invoices from a client.
- A landlord filing a claim against a former tenant for unpaid rent.
